    The Lockheed Constellation ("Connie") was a propeller-driven airliner powered by four 18-cylinder radial Wright R-3350 engines. It was built by Lockheed between 1943 and 1958 at its Burbank, California, US, facility. A total of 856 aircraft were produced in four models, all distinguished by a triple-tail design and dolphin-shaped fuselage.

The Sikorsky/Lockheed Martin VH-92 Patriot [3] is an American helicopter under development to replace the United States Marine Corps ' Marine One U.S. presidential transport fleet. It is a militarized variant of the Sikorsky S-92 and is larger than the current Marine One helicopters.
